I stand here, beneath the verdant oak, and extend my arms in warm embrace, to my brothers and sisters, to the spirits and the gods, as their love washes me clean, for a new day.
I stand here, above the rushing waters, as they carry my words, to those who would drink, of my little chalice, of precious wisdom.
I stand here, on the windswept crag, and extend my heart, that it might shelter, all who come to the Isles, with its spirit of love.
I stand here, that you may come, and whisper to me of, fragrant gardens, sheltered groves, mighty rivers, ancient books, and that I may then shout, my joy to the sky!
I stand here, with head bowed in gratitude, for your tales of wandering, of pilgrimage and of hope, for the fire in your heads, and the love in your hearts. For all this I will stand here, until the final sunset.
